Understanding Martin County’s Pool Installation Requirements

A permit is required to construct an above-ground swimming pool in Martin County. Permits are also needed for swimming pools with or without decks. This comprehensive permitting process ensures that all pool installations meet safety standards and comply with local zoning regulations.

The county’s approach to pool safety extends beyond basic installation requirements. A permit is required to install swimming pool barrier in Martin County, and a permit is required to construct a pool enclosure with or without a slab in Martin County. These multiple permit requirements demonstrate the county’s commitment to comprehensive pool safety.

The Critical Role of Property Surveys in Pool Installation

One of the most important aspects of pool installation compliance involves accurate property surveying to determine setback requirements. Setbacks are dependent upon the Zoning District that applies to the property. There may be environmental buffers and setbacks required on properties in addition to the Zoning district setback. This makes professional surveying essential for determining exactly where your pool can be legally installed.

Florida Building Code requirements specify that setback between pools and slopes shall be equal to one-half the building footing setback distance required. Additionally, pool walls within a horizontal distance of 7 feet from the top of the slope shall be capable of supporting the water. These technical requirements underscore why professional surveying is not optional but necessary.

Compliance with Safety Standards

Martin County’s pool safety ordinance aligns with broader Florida safety requirements. Chapter 41 of the Florida Building Code, Residential and Chapter 4 of the Building Code, Building provide code requirements for residential swimming pools. The language in both chapters is the same with the exception that Chapter 4 of the Building Code, Building is more inclusive.

The surveying process helps ensure compliance with barrier requirements, which specify that all doors and windows providing direct access from the home to the pool must be equipped with an exit and that screened or protected windows with a bottom sill height of at least 48 inches are properly positioned.
